Background technology
Steel nail is to use a series of production technologies, and the nail monomer of regular arrangement is effectively integrated, is passed through
Special sticky glue is integrated, and the fixed regular nail of monoblock arrangement is formed.It generally includes flat head, bar portion
And tip composition, the decoration for being commonly used to wood materials are fixed use, are fixed using nail rifle.Existing steel nail is in line nail,
Nail rifle is in line nail gun, but due in line the problems such as following closely the mechanical realization principle for using right angle configuration and in line nail gun, right
In 90 degree of inner corner trim bottom reinforcing process of interior decoration and Furniture manufacture, the binding slot of in line nail gun and the meeting of power shell and wall
Or working face generates interference, can not be reinforced to this position, can only carry out manual reinforcing, and it is extremely inconvenient, then invent
Oblique nail and matched skew nailing rifle.Currently, because of technical difficulty problem, 1.5 millimeters or more line footpaths can only be produced
Skew nailing, and purposes is limited only to building element reinforcing, material utilization amount is big and not economical enough, can not be used for Furniture manufacture and room
Interior decoration.Therefore it is badly in need of designing the nail machine that can produce the 0.8-1.3 millimeters of oblique nails of line footpath, makes the oblique nail produced not only
Have the function of in line nail, and in line nail can be substituted completely.

The course of work of nail machine is:Step (1), operating personnel open the operating switch in PLC controller, chainriveting tape
It is delivered to by feed mechanism on the molding basis platform of cut-out punching mechanism, first sensor is used to detect chainriveting tape movement
It distance and time used, has some setbacks when chainriveting tape encounters feeding, when overlong time used, first sensor feeds back information
To PLC controller, PLC controller is automatically stopped the first driving mechanism, and mold is protected not weighed wounded;Step (2) is molded bottom platen
It under the driving of the first driving mechanism, is moved down along guide post is pushed, with the basic platform pairing of molding, punching press is carried out to chainriveting tape and is cut
It is disconnected, oblique chainriveting tape is formed, 3rd sensor is used to detect the pushing displacement of the first driving mechanism;Step (3) is molded bottom platen
After the basic platform pairing of molding, bump forming mechanism is flexible in the platform of control punching press basis under the driving of the second driving mechanism
Punching carries out punching press to the end of oblique chainriveting tape, so that the oblique chainriveting tape end that is stamped is formed the head of a nail, the 4th sensor is for examining
Survey the side pressure displacement of the second driving mechanism;Step (4) is stretched after the completion of punching punching press, and bump forming mechanism is in the second driving machine
Under the driving of structure, the punching retraction that stretches is controlled, is then molded bottom platen under the driving of the first driving mechanism, edge pushes on guide post
It moves;Step (5), the cylinder being fixedly mounted on operation console control the end two of the upward fast ram liftout transverse slat of its output end
Secondary, because liftout transverse slat is placed on the lower section of oblique nail, positioning guide block will certainly be detached from by oblique nail by hitting liftout transverse slat, be gone out at this time
Expect that output driving machine is started to work in mechanism, under the drive of push pull rod, pushing plate along sliding slot quick sliding, by oblique nail from
It is popped up on the basic platform of molding, during oblique nail is ejected, liftout transverse slat resets under the action of spring-return power, push
Plate also resets under the drive of output driving machine, and second sensor is for detecting the time that pushing plate moves back and forth in sliding slot;
Step (6), feed mechanism continue chainriveting tape being delivered on the basic platform of molding, and so on move.
The device have the advantages that:
(1) present invention be it is a kind of will cut process, molding procedure, output process unification, production efficiency can be greatly improved
It is suitable for Furniture manufacture and interior with the oblique nail of the oblique nail process equipment of product quality, produced 0.8-1.3 millimeters of line footpath
Finishing, which not only has the function of in line nail, but also can substitute in line nail completely, solves interior decoration and furniture
The problem of 90 degree of inner corner trim bottoms of manufacture can not reinforce, can be reinforced without dead angle in all directions.
(2) oblique nail forming tank is combined to form by upper forming tank and lower forming tank, punching press is carried out to oblique chainriveting tape, is made
The boss to match with nail forming tank is squeezed out with each nail, which gets loose existing after can preventing nail from hammering into object
As.
(3) by the end set for the punching that stretches in the fin of stair shape arrangement, each fin corresponds to a flat wire, makes
After the end of oblique chainriveting tape is stamped, each skew nailing corresponds to a head of a nail, and dislocation-free phenomenon between the head of a nail ensures hitting for nail gun
Needle can vertically push out skew nailing.
(4) by the way that there are two the 5th sensors far from being set at pushing plate on the basic platform of molding, and the two sensors are equal
The lower section that track is popped up positioned at oblique nail, when detecting that oblique nail passes through the time used in the distance between two the 5th sensors
When long, PLC controller can be fed back information to, PLC controller is automatically stopped the first, second driving mechanism, protects mold not
It is weighed wounded.
(5) during punching press, expansion of metal power that oblique nail is generated due to being squeezed is by the head of a nail of oblique nail
It is stuck between positioning guide block, by the way that liftout transverse slat and cylinder is arranged, cylinder moment hits the end of liftout transverse slat twice so that tiltedly
Nail thoroughly breaks away from the constraint of expansion of metal power, is detached from positioning guide block.
(6) each component in the present invention is process with numer centre, and parts precision is high, can reach oblique nail high-precision
Manufacture requirement.
(7) skewed slot tilts 15 ° of -35 ° of settings, by changing skewed slot angle of inclination, it is possible to produce oblique with various gradients
The oblique nail that nail gun matches.
